Highlights
Are people in Edgefield older or younger than people in Albion?
- The Median Age in Edgefield is 12.6 years older than in Albion.
Are housing costs cheaper in Edgefield or Albion?
- Edgefield
housing
costs are 18.3% less expensive than Albion housing costs.
Which city has a longer commute, Edgefield or Albion?
- The average commute for residents of Edgefield is 3.4 minutes longer than it is for residents of Albion.
Things to do in Albion?
Living in Albion, IN is a great experience. With its friendly small town atmosphere and wide variety of outdoor activities, there’s something for everyone. The town is surrounded by beautiful farmland and rolling hills, making it an ideal spot to enjoy the outdoors. There are plenty of parks to explore, including the nearby Chain O'Lakes State Park. Albion also has several restaurants and shops to explore, giving visitors and locals alike plenty of options for dining and entertainment. The local schools are top-notch as well, providing high-quality education for students. All in all, Albion is a great place to call home!
Things to do in Edgefield?
Edgefield, SC is a small town located in the heart of South Carolina. It offers a peaceful, rural atmosphere with plenty of outdoor activities to keep residents busy and content. The community is close-knit and friendly, with people from all walks of life making up its population. There are ample opportunities for shopping, dining, and entertainment as well as plenty of parks and trails for enjoying the outdoors. The town offers a low cost of living, with housing prices far below the national average. Edgefield is truly a great place to call home!
